Hardwood flooring is an excellent choice for attic flooring, offering a range of aesthetic and practical advantages.

Here are some reasons why you should consider hardwood flooring for your attic:

Aesthetic: Hardwood flooring adds warmth and beauty to the attic space, creating an elegant and comfortable atmosphere.

Durable: Hardwood is a durable material that can withstand heavy traffic and wear.

Easy to maintain: Hardwood flooring is relatively easy to maintain and can be cleaned with a simple mop and mild detergent.

Versatile: Hardwood flooring is available in a variety of colors, styles, and wood species, so you can find the perfect floor to match your attic's decor.

Value: Hardwood flooring can increase the value of your property.
